我试图尽可能有效地做到这一点。
我有多个数组:
array1 = [
"2018" =>
[
"JAN" => 100,
"FEB" => 200,
"MAR" => 300,
"APR" => 400
]
]
array2 = [
"2018" =>
[
"FEB" => 200,
"MAR" => 300,
"APR" => 400,
"MAY" => 200,
]
]
array3 = [
"2018" =>
[
"MAY" => 200,
"JUN" => 100,
"JUL" => 300,
"AUG" => 400,
]
]
我想将这些数组与所需的年/月总计输出相加:
sumArray = [
"2018" =>
[
"JAN" => 100,
"FEB" => 400,
"MAR" => 600,
"APR" => 800
"MAY" => 400,
"JUN" => 100,
"JUL" => 300,
"AUG" => 400,
]
]
我想避免多个 foreach 循环,并认为使用 array_map、array_walk 或其他任何东西会有更好的解决方案。有人有想法吗?
谢谢